Why Is My Sink Not Draining?
It's not typical for your cooking area sink to clog up multiple times in one month. If your sink blocks twice a week, there's some difficulty going on.
An obstructed cooking area drainpipe does not simply slow down your chores, it deteriorates your whole plumbing system, bit by bit. Here are some common practices that motivate sink blockages, and how to prevent them.

You require proper waste disposal


Recycling waste is great, however do you take notice of your natural waste also? Your cooking area needs to have 2 different waste boxes; one for recyclable plastics and also an additional for natural waste, which can end up being garden compost.
Having a designated trash bag will assist you as well as your household stay clear of tossing pasta and also various other food residues away. Commonly, these residues absorb moisture and become blockages.

A person attempted to clean their hair in the cooking area sink


There's a correct time and also area for every little thing. The kitchen area sink is just not the best location to wash your hair. Washing your hair in the kitchen sink will certainly make it block eventually unless you utilize a drain catcher.
While a drainpipe catcher could capture a lot of the after effects, some strands may still get through. If you have thick hair, this may be enough to slow down your drainage and eventually create an obstruction.

You're tossing coffee down the tubes


Utilized coffee premises as well as coffee beans still take in a considerable amount of moisture. They may seem little adequate to throw down the drainpipe, however as time takes place they begin to swell and take up more room.
Your coffee premises need to enter into natural garbage disposal. Whatever portion gets away (possibly while you're washing up) will certainly be cared for throughout your regular monthly clean-up.

You have actually been consuming a great deal of greasy foods


Your kitchen sink might still obtain obstructed despite organic waste disposal. This might be since you have a diet plan rich in oily foods like cheeseburgers.
This grease coats the insides of pipelines, making them narrower as well as more clog-prone.

Your pipeline wasn't fixed appropriately in the first place


If you've been doing none of the above, however still get normal blockages in your kitchen sink, you should certainly call a plumber. There may be a problem with just how your pipelines were installed.
While your plumber gets here, look for any type of leaks or abnormalities around your kitchen pipelines. Do not attempt to deal with the pipelines yourself. This might trigger an accident or a kitchen area flood.

There's more dust than your pipes can take care of


If you get fruits straight from a farm, you might discover even more kitchen area dust than other people that shop from a shopping center. You can easily repair this by cleaning the fruits as well as veggies properly before bringing them right into your home.

Thaw the sludge


  • 1. Pour one-half mug baking soft drink right into the drain complied with by one-half cup white vinegar; the fizzy and bubbling reaction aids to break up little clogs.

  • 2. Block the drain using a tiny rag so the chain reaction does not all bubble up out.

  • 3. Wait 15 minutes.

  • 4. Currently put a kettle's worth of boiling thin down the drainpipe and run warm water for several minutes to more flush out the melted slime.

    5 Things to Do if You Want to Unclog Your Kitchen Sink


    Trick 1: Don’t Put Vegetable Peelings Down Disposal



    Although the garbage disposal is a powerful and useful way to get rid of food waste, it is not meant for certain vegetables. Don’t put potato, carrot or celery peelings down the disposal. These veggies are fibrous or contain a lot of starch which can jam the disposal motor and clog your sink drain-piping every time. There are other food items that occasionally will clog your sink. If this happens, follow the next four tips.


    Trick 2: Use Your Plunger


    Plunger is a must-have tool for every household because it can be used to unclog any drain in any part of the house including the kitchen. Yes, the simple plunger can unclog your kitchen sink too. When you use the plunger, plug the other holes in you kitchen sink with a rag cloth. Also, ensure that the plunger cup completely covers the clogged kitchen sink hole. Now, keep the plunger in an upright position and plunge about ten times vigorously. This should remove any vegetable peels, food leftovers or any other solids in the kitchen sink.


    Trick 3: Clear the P-trap


    The P-trap is the pipe below your sink that’s shaped like the letter P (on its side). You should be able to spot it when you look in the cabinet below your sink. This pipe, shaped to provide a seal against sewer odors, gets clogged when receiving larger solid objects. To unclog the P-trap, you need a pair of gloves and a bucket. You should unscrew the large nut on both the sides of the trap with your bare hands and remove the pipe. Make sure you place a bucket right below the trap to collect all the unclogged water. You can also run your hands through the pipe to remove any solid objects.


    Trick 4: Use a Metal Wire


    Sometimes using a metal wire to push down or pull up debris from your drain can help unclog your kitchen sink. If you don’t have a metal wire, unbend a wire hanger and use it in the kitchen drain hole. Since this is time-consuming, you’d only use this trick as a last resort. It works well when you know what’s inside the drain.


    Trick 5: Use a Drain Snake


    Go to your local hardware store and buy a short manual-crank drain snake. This tool is fairly inexpensive and works well unless the clog is further down the drain, past the P-trap.



    If none of the above tricks work, then you should call an expert right away, especially since clogged drains are the perfect breeding ground for all kinds of bacteria and viruses.
